Frequently Asked Questions ?

What are Jhumki earrings and how do they differ from traditional jhumka designs?

Jhumki earrings are a type of Indian jewelry known for their bell-shaped design and intricate craftsmanship. While both 'Jhumki' and 'traditional jhumka' refer to similar styles, Jhumki earrings often feature more contemporary twists, whereas traditional jhumka are characterized by classic details and cultural motifs.

Are Jhumki earrings suitable for daily wear or only for special occasions?

Jhumki earrings come in a variety of designs, from lightweight, simple patterns for daily wear to elaborate traditional jhumka perfect for weddings and festivals. Depending on your style and comfort, you can choose Jhumki earrings for everyday use or select more ornate pieces for special occasions.

What materials are commonly used in making traditional jhumka or Jhumki earrings?

Traditional jhumka and Jhumki earrings are typically crafted from metals such as gold, silver, brass, or copper, and are often adorned with pearls, beads, gemstones, or enamel work to enhance their appeal.

How should I take care of my Jhumki earrings to ensure their longevity?

To maintain the beauty of your Jhumki earrings or traditional jhumka, store them in a dry place, avoid contact with water or perfumes, and clean them with a soft cloth after use. Regular care will help preserve their shine and intricate detailing.
